Dover uses strong 4th quarter to take down WiHi

SALISBURY, Md. – The Dover Senators remain undefeated after taking down WiHi 50-35 on day 3 of the Governors Challenge. The Tribe led by two after the first quarter. Dover responded by winning the next two quarters 28-20 and went on a 15-4 in the fourth quarter to secure the victory. Sarah Benson and Ashtyn Torbert combined for 26 points to lead the senators. But their defense in slowing down WiHi’s Se’Lah Foreman is what won them the game. Forman was held to 10 points on 5-16 shooting.
